The Opportunity
This position works out of Ontario in the Diabetes Care Division. We’re focused on helping people with diabetes manage their health with life-changing products that provide accurate data to drive better-informed decisions. We’re revolutionizing the way people monitor their glucose levels with our new sensing technology. The Manager, HTA & Stakeholder Submissions is responsible for leading and executing ADC’s public, private and HTA submission plan in alignment with ADC market access initiatives to secure optimal access for ADC products, ensuring comprehensive submission dossiers and managing post-submission requirements. The position reports to the Senior Manager, HTA & Stakeholder Relations.
What You’ll Do
Market Access & Strategy
Assess market landscape, standard of care, and value positioning to support pricing and contracting strategies.
Monitor Canadian healthcare dynamics and policy changes impacting ADC products.
Serve as an expert in Health Technology Assessment (HTA) and reimbursement trends.
Submissions & Reimbursement
Lead public, private, and HTA submissions.
Develop and execute access strategies across all Canadian markets.
Translate clinical and economic data into compelling payer messages.
Build and maintain competitive pricing and reimbursement strategies.
Negotiate contracts and represent ADC in external discussions.
Cross-Functional Leadership
Drive Market Access strategy across product lifecycle and indications.
Lead cross-functional teams and mentor on access strategies.
Collaborate with global and local teams to align on best practices and policy shaping.
Ensure payer perspectives are integrated into development and commercial plans.
Stakeholder Engagement
Build strong relationships with government, payors, providers, and advocacy groups.
Partner with internal teams (Medical, Marketing, Stakeholder Relations) to ensure ADC’s value proposition is recognized and supported.
Required Qualifications
Bachelor of Arts or Bachelor of Science; Masters, PharmD or PhD in a related field preferred
Proven leader with seven or more years of experience in areas such as Market Access, HTA, Clinical Epidemiology, Health Economics, Outcomes Research, Patient-Reported Outcomes, and Quality of Life in a pharmaceutical or medical device company or consulting company.
Demonstrated working knowledge of Canadian health care system and Provincial coverage and reimbursement processes is required; experience achieving coverage and reimbursement for new medical devices in Canada preferred.
Understanding of HTA, evidenced based medicine, clinical study design and health economics.
Outstanding strategic thinking skills—proven ability to identify/define business questions and issues, synthesize information from multiple sources, conduct analysis, formulate actionable recommendations.
High-energy, self-starter that is assertive, possesses a high degree of self-confidence and intellectual curiosity, exhibits a bias for action and demonstrates good executive presence.
Exceptional oral and written communication skills, with the ability to interact effectively with ADC Senior Management, Key Opinion Leaders, Patient Advocacy Groups and key stakeholders from public and private payors.
Proven ability to manage multiple tasks concurrently under aggressive timelines in a dynamic environment while maintaining strong attention to detail and quick recall • Strong working knowledge of statistics, finance and accounting concepts (e.g., ROI, P&L).
